1. Understanding Cryptocurrency


At its core, cryptocurrency is a form of digital or virtual currency secured by cryptography, making it nearly impossible to counterfeit or double-spend. Unlike traditional currencies issued by governments (fiat currencies), cryptocurrencies operate on decentralized networks based on blockchain technology. Blockchain serves as a distributed ledger that records all transactions across a network of computers, ensuring transparency, immutability, and security.


2.The Birth of Bitcoin


Bitcoin, introduced in a 2008 whitepaper by an anonymous figure known as Satoshi Nakamoto, marked the birth of the first cryptocurrency. Built on the principles of decentralization and cryptographic security, Bitcoin aimed to create a peer-to-peer electronic cash system, free from the control of central authorities. Since then, thousands of alternative cryptocurrencies, collectively referred to as altcoins, have emerged, each with its own unique features and use cases.


3. Key Concepts and Terminology


Before delving deeper into the world of cryptocurrency, it's essential to familiarize oneself with key concepts and terminology:


1. **Wallets**: Digital wallets store cryptocurrency holdings and facilitate transactions on blockchain networks. They come in various forms, including software wallets, hardware wallets, and paper wallets.


2. **Mining**: Mining is the process by which new cryptocurrency coins are created and transactions are verified on a blockchain network. Miners use powerful computers to solve complex mathematical puzzles, adding new blocks to the blockchain and securing the network in exchange for rewards.


3. **Public and Private Keys**: Public keys serve as addresses for receiving cryptocurrency, while private keys are used to access and manage funds. It's crucial to safeguard private keys, as they grant full control over cryptocurrency holdings.


4. **Volatility**: Cryptocurrency markets are known for their high volatility, with prices often experiencing significant fluctuations over short periods. Factors such as market demand, regulatory developments, and technological advancements can influence price movements.


4.Use Cases and Adoption


Cryptocurrency has found application across various industries and sectors, offering innovative solutions to longstanding challenges:


1. **Payments**: Cryptocurrencies like Bitcoin and Litecoin enable fast, borderless transactions with lower fees compared to traditional payment methods. Some merchants and businesses now accept cryptocurrency payments, expanding options for consumers worldwide.


2. **Decentralized Finance (DeFi)**: DeFi platforms leverage blockchain technology to provide financial services without intermediaries, offering features such as lending, borrowing, and decentralized exchanges. These platforms aim to democratize access to financial services and promote financial inclusion.


3. **Smart Contracts**: Smart contracts are self-executing contracts with the terms of the agreement directly written into code. They enable automated and trustless transactions on blockchain networks, eliminating the need for intermediaries and reducing the risk of fraud.


5. Challenges and Risks


While cryptocurrency holds immense potential, it also faces significant challenges and risks:


1. **Regulatory Uncertainty**: Regulatory frameworks for cryptocurrency vary widely across jurisdictions, leading to uncertainty and compliance challenges for businesses and users. Regulatory crackdowns and bans in certain countries can impact market sentiment and adoption.


2. **Security Concerns**: Despite the robust security features of blockchain technology, cryptocurrencies are not immune to hacking, fraud, and theft. Vulnerabilities in smart contracts, exchange breaches, and phishing attacks pose risks to users' funds and personal information.


3. **Scalability**: Scalability remains a key issue for many blockchain networks, limiting their ability to handle large transaction volumes efficiently. Solutions such as layer-two scaling and consensus algorithm upgrades are being explored to address this challenge.
